Drag the correct symbol into the box to compare expessions<br> 6^2-2^2___4(6+2)<br> A.≠<br> B.=
Mnenie [13.5K]

Simplify both sides to compare:

6^2 - 2^2 = 36-4 = 32


4(6+2) = 4 x 8 = 32


they are equal to each other.


Answer: B. =

What is the length of side x?<br><br> A. 6<br><br> B. 8.5<br><br> C. 11<br><br> D. 11.5
svet-max [94.6K]

Set up a proportion.

3/6 = 5.5 / x Cross multiply

3x = 6*5.5

3x = 33 Divide by 3

x = 33/3

x = 11

The length of x is 11.

Which of these equations is always true?
Lera25 [3.4K]

Answer:

sin(x) = cos(90°-x)

Step-by-step explanation:

Looking at the graphs of sin(x) and cos(x), you can see that the peaks of the graph are separated by a value of pi/2. If you convert that value into degrees, then the two graphs are separated by 90°. Another way of thinking is from the unit circle. sin(x) = 1 at 90°, and cos(x)=1 at 0°. The difference is still 90°
